forum.wfido.ru  

Вернуться   forum.wfido.ru > Прочие эхи > RU.UNIX.BSD

Ответ
 
Опции темы Опции просмотра
  #1  
Старый 25.02.2025, 15:01
Andrey Ostanovsky
Guest
 
Сообщений: n/a
По умолчанию 'libdwarf.h' file not found

Andrey Ostanovsky написал(а) к All в Feb 25 13:40:42 по местному времени:

Нello All!

Второй день пытаюсь выполнить "make buildworld" на FreeBSD 13.4-RELEASE.

Пробовал использовать директорию /usr/src после freebsd-update,
скачивал дерево исходников гитом и готовым архивом src.txz.

Результат - одинаков:

>/usr/src/contrib/elftoolchain/nm/nm.c:41:10: fatal error: 'libdwarf.h'
>file not found
> 41 | #include <libdwarf.h>
> | ^~~~~~~~~~~~
>1 error generated.
>* Error code 1



# freebsd-version -kru
13.4-RELEASE-p3
13.4-RELEASE-p3
13.4-RELEASE-p3

Извечный русский вопрос: что делать?


Andrey

--- GoldED+/BSD 1.1.5-b20170303-b20170303
Ответить с цитированием
  #2  
Старый 26.02.2025, 21:21
Alex Korchmar
Guest
 
Сообщений: n/a
По умолчанию Re: 'libdwarf.h' file not found

Alex Korchmar написал(а) к Andrey Ostanovsky в Feb 25 20:09:09 по местному времени:

From: Alex Korchmar <noreply@linux.e-moe.ru>

Andrey Ostanovsky <Andrey.Ostanovsky@f1957.n5030.z2.fidonet.org> wrote:

AO> Извечный русский вопрос: что делать?
искать проблему в /usr/share/Mk или make.conf/src.conf - я больше
в первое верю.

У тебя ж небось это - не установлено на чистый диск, а результат апгрейда?

> Alex

--- ifmail v.2.15dev5.4
Ответить с цитированием
  #3  
Старый 28.02.2025, 02:01
Eugene Grosbein
Guest
 
Сообщений: n/a
По умолчанию Re: 'libdwarf.h' file not found

Eugene Grosbein написал(а) к Andrey Ostanovsky в Feb 25 04:47:48 по местному времени:

25 февр. 2025, вторник, в 13:40 NOVT, Andrey Ostanovsky написал(а):

AO> Второй день пытаюсь выполнить "make buildworld" на FreeBSD 13.4-RELEASE.
AO> Пробовал использовать директорию /usr/src после freebsd-update,
AO> скачивал дерево исходников гитом и готовым архивом src.txz.
AO> Результат - одинаков:
>>/usr/src/contrib/elftoolchain/nm/nm.c:41:10: fatal error: 'libdwarf.h'
>>file not found
>> 41 | #include <libdwarf.h>
>> | ^~~~~~~~~~~~
>>1 error generated.
>>* Error code 1
AO> # freebsd-version -kru
AO> 13.4-RELEASE-p3
AO> Извечный русский вопрос: что делать?

Проверь наличие /usr/src/contrib/elftoolchain/libdwarf/libdwarf.h
Погляди в dmesg на предмет странной ругани ядра, есть ли таковая?

Eugene
--
What would you do with a brain if you had one?
--- slrn/1.0.3 (FreeBSD)
Ответить с цитированием
  #4  
Старый 01.03.2025, 10:41
Andrey Ostanovsky
Guest
 
Сообщений: n/a
По умолчанию 'libdwarf.h' file not found

Andrey Ostanovsky написал(а) к Eugene Grosbein в Mar 25 09:14:04 по местному времени:

Нello Eugene!

28 Feb 25 04:47, you wrote to me:

AO>> Второй день пытаюсь выполнить "make buildworld" на FreeBSD
AO>> 13.4-RELEASE. Пробовал использовать директорию /usr/src после
AO>> freebsd-update, скачивал дерево исходников гитом и готовым
AO>> архивом src.txz. Результат - одинаков:
>>> /usr/src/contrib/elftoolchain/nm/nm.c:41:10: fatal error:
>>> 'libdwarf.h' file not found
>>> 41 | #include <libdwarf.h>
>>> | ^~~~~~~~~~~~
>>> 1 error generated.
>>> * Error code 1
AO>> # freebsd-version -kru
AO>> 13.4-RELEASE-p3
AO>> Извечный русский вопрос: что делать?

EG> Проверь наличие /usr/src/contrib/elftoolchain/libdwarf/libdwarf.h

Это было первое, что я полез проверять: имеется этот файлик в наличии.

EG> Погляди в dmesg на предмет странной ругани ядра, есть ли таковая?

Не видно.

Andrey

--- GoldED+/BSD 1.1.5-b20170303-b20170303
Ответить с цитированием
  #5  
Старый 03.03.2025, 16:11
Andrey Ostanovsky
Guest
 
Сообщений: n/a
По умолчанию 'libdwarf.h' file not found

Andrey Ostanovsky написал(а) к Alex Korchmar в Mar 25 14:52:44 по местному времени:

Нello Alex!

26 Feb 25 20:09, you wrote to me:

AO>> Извечный русский вопрос: что делать?
AK> искать проблему в /usr/share/Mk или make.conf/src.conf - я больше
AK> в первое верю.

Заменил /usr/share/mk на новое из свежего src - результат тот же.

/usr/obj/... - тоже почищено.

Andrey

--- GoldED+/BSD 1.1.5-b20170303-b20170303
Ответить с цитированием
  #6  
Старый 05.03.2025, 03:01
Sergey Dorofeev
Guest
 
Сообщений: n/a
По умолчанию 'libdwarf.h' file not found

Sergey Dorofeev написал(а) к Andrey Ostanovsky в Mar 25 01:37:36 по местному времени:

Нello Andrey,

orig.message to echo RU.UNIX.BSD on 25 Feb 25 13:40:42
AO> Второй день пытаюсь выполнить "make buildworld" на FreeBSD 13.4-RELEASE.
AO>
AO> Пробовал использовать директорию /usr/src после freebsd-update,
AO> скачивал дерево исходников гитом и готовым архивом src.txz.
AO>
AO> Результат - одинаков:
AO>
>> /usr/src/contrib/elftoolchain/nm/nm.c:41:10: fatal error: 'libdwarf.h'
>> file not found
>> 41 | #include <libdwarf.h>

Обычно он в /usr/include лежит, он там есть?

Sergey

... vim
--- PyFTN
Ответить с цитированием
  #7  
Старый 05.03.2025, 14:11
Eugene Grosbein
Guest
 
Сообщений: n/a
По умолчанию Re: 'libdwarf.h' file not found

Eugene Grosbein написал(а) к Andrey Ostanovsky в Mar 25 16:51:44 по местному времени:

25 февр. 2025, вторник, в 13:40 NOVT, Andrey Ostanovsky написал(а):

AO> Второй день пытаюсь выполнить "make buildworld" на FreeBSD 13.4-RELEASE.
AO> Пробовал использовать директорию /usr/src после freebsd-update,
AO> скачивал дерево исходников гитом и готовым архивом src.txz.
AO> Результат - одинаков:
AO> >/usr/src/contrib/elftoolchain/nm/nm.c:41:10: fatal error: 'libdwarf.h'
AO> >file not found
AO> > 41 | #include <libdwarf.h>
AO> > | ^~~~~~~~~~~~
AO> >1 error generated.
AO> >* Error code 1
AO> # freebsd-version -kru
AO> 13.4-RELEASE-p3
AO> 13.4-RELEASE-p3
AO> 13.4-RELEASE-p3
AO> Извечный русский вопрос: что делать?

Возможно, у тебя что-то недефолтное в /etc/src.conf и ломающее сборку.

Eugene
--
Прекрасны тонко отшлифованная драгоценность; победитель, раненный в бою;
слон во время течки; река, высыхающая зимой; луна на исходе; юная женщина,
изнуренная наслаждением, и даятель, отдавший все нищим. (Дхарма)
--- slrn/1.0.3 (FreeBSD)
Ответить с цитированием
  #8  
Старый 19.03.2025, 13:21
Andrey Ostanovsky
Guest
 
Сообщений: n/a
По умолчанию 'libdwarf.h' file not found

Andrey Ostanovsky написал(а) к Sergey Dorofeev в Mar 25 12:07:42 по местному времени:

Нello Sergey!

05 Mar 25 01:37, you wrote to me:

AO>> Второй день пытаюсь выполнить "make buildworld" на FreeBSD
AO>> 13.4-RELEASE.
AO>> Пробовал использовать директорию /usr/src после freebsd-update,
AO>> скачивал дерево исходников гитом и готовым архивом src.txz.
AO>> Результат - одинаков:
>>> /usr/src/contrib/elftoolchain/nm/nm.c:41:10: fatal error:
>>> 'libdwarf.h' file not found 41 | #include <libdwarf.h>

SD> Обычно он в /usr/include лежит, он там есть?

Не было. :( Положил туда libdwarf.h из /usr/src и всё нормально собралось. Спасибо!

"Всё больше люблю собак"(с)

Andrey

--- GoldED+/BSD 1.1.5-b20170303-b20170303
Ответить с цитированием
  #9  
Старый 21.03.2025, 02:51
Sergey Dorofeev
Guest
 
Сообщений: n/a
По умолчанию 'libdwarf.h' file not found

Sergey Dorofeev написал(а) к Andrey Ostanovsky в Mar 25 01:27:35 по местному времени:

Нello Andrey,

orig.message to echo RU.UNIX.BSD on 19 Mar 25 12:07:42
>>>> 'libdwarf.h' file not found 41 | #include <libdwarf.h>
SD>> Обычно он в /usr/include лежит, он там есть?
AO> Не было. :( Положил туда libdwarf.h из /usr/src и всё нормально
AO> собралось. Спасибо!

Вопрос, почему исчез. Он же при первичной установке туда попадает, в пакетах его нету.

Sergey

... vim
--- PyFTN
Ответить с цитированием
Ответ


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.

Быстрый переход


Текущее время: 06:31. Часовой пояс GMT +4.


Powered by vBulletin® Version 3.8.7
Copyright ©2000 - 2025, vBulletin Solutions, Inc. Перевод: zCarot